Huntington Bancshares (HBAN)

Overview: Huntington Bancshares Incorporated, with a market cap of $36.61 billion, operates as the bank holding company for The Huntington National Bank, offering commercial, consumer, and mortgage banking services.

Operations: The company's revenue is primarily derived from Consumer & Regional Banking, contributing $5.65 billion, followed by Commercial Banking at $3 billion.

Estimated Discount To Fair Value: 45.8%

Huntington Bancshares appears undervalued, trading at US$18.17, significantly below its estimated future cash flow value of US$33.55. Despite a forecasted earnings growth of 26.2% annually over three years, the company has faced substantial shareholder dilution and significant insider selling recently. It maintains a reliable dividend yield of 3.41% and is actively repurchasing shares under a US$3 billion buyback program, which may enhance shareholder value despite current low return on equity forecasts.

Coherent (COHR)

Overview: Coherent Corp. is a company that develops, manufactures, and markets engineered materials, optoelectronic components and devices, and laser systems for industrial, communications, electronics, and instrumentation markets globally with a market cap of approximately $62.06 billion.

Operations: The company's revenue segments include $1.62 billion from networking, $1.42 billion from materials, and $2.80 billion from lasers.

Estimated Discount To Fair Value: 22%

Coherent is trading at US$317.22, well below its estimated future cash flow value of US$406.73, highlighting potential undervaluation. Despite recent shareholder dilution and high share price volatility, earnings are forecasted to grow significantly at 47.5% annually over three years, outpacing market expectations. Recent business expansions under the CHIPS Act and partnerships with NVIDIA bolster its growth prospects in AI infrastructure and optical networking technologies, positioning it favorably for future demand increases.

Fifth Third Bancorp (FITB)

Overview: Fifth Third Bancorp is the bank holding company for Fifth Third Bank, National Association, offering a variety of financial products and services across the United States with a market cap of approximately $52.04 billion.

Operations: Fifth Third Bank, National Association generates its revenue through a diverse range of financial products and services offered across the United States.

Estimated Discount To Fair Value: 39%

Fifth Third Bancorp, trading at US$57.66, is significantly undervalued compared to its estimated future cash flow value of US$94.54. The company has revised its 2026 earnings guidance upwards, with net interest income expected between $8.74 billion and $8.80 billion, reflecting strong growth in commercial payments and asset management sectors. Despite recent insider selling and shareholder dilution, earnings are projected to grow at 22.1% annually over three years, surpassing market expectations.
